随着人工智能(AI)技术的不断发展,其在各个领域的应用越来越广泛。然而,AI技术在实际应用中也面临着许多挑战和痛点。本文将探讨识别与解决这些常见问题的方法。
1. 数据问题:AI应用的基础是数据,但数据的质量和数量直接影响到AI模型的性能。因此,数据问题是一个普遍存在的痛点。为了解决这一问题,可以采取以下措施:首先,收集高质量的、多样化的数据;其次,对数据进行清洗和预处理,去除噪音和异常值;最后,使用合适的特征工程方法提取有用的特征。
2. 模型泛化能力不足:AI模型往往在训练数据上表现良好,但在新数据上的表现却不尽如人意。这是因为模型过于依赖训练数据的特征,而忽略了其他可能有用的信息。为了提高模型的泛化能力,可以尝试以下方法:首先,使用正则化技术来防止过拟合;其次,使用迁移学习技术将预训练模型应用于新的任务;最后,采用多任务学习或自监督学习等方法来解决跨领域的任务。
3. 可解释性差:AI模型的决策过程往往是黑箱的,这使得人们难以理解模型的工作原理。为了提高模型的可解释性,可以采取以下措施:首先,选择具有良好可解释性的模型架构;其次,使用可视化工具展示模型的中间步骤;最后,通过专家审查和解释性分析来提高模型的可解释性。
4. 计算资源消耗大:AI模型通常需要大量的计算资源来训练和推理。为了降低计算资源的消耗,可以采取以下措施:首先,使用分布式计算和并行计算技术来提高计算效率;其次,使用量化技术和剪枝技术来减少模型的大小和复杂度;最后,采用硬件加速技术如GPU和TPU来提高计算性能。
5. 安全性问题:AI系统可能会受到恶意攻击,导致数据泄露或系统崩溃。为了提高安全性,可以采取以下措施:首先,使用加密技术和访问控制来保护敏感数据;其次,使用安全审计和监控来检测潜在的安全威胁;最后,定期进行安全漏洞扫描和渗透测试以确保系统的安全性。
6. 伦理和法律问题:AI技术的应用涉及到许多伦理和法律问题,如隐私保护、歧视问题和责任归属等。为了解决这些问题,可以采取以下措施:首先,制定明确的法律法规来规范AI技术的发展和应用;其次,建立伦理准则和指导原则来引导AI系统的设计和开发;最后,加强公众教育和意识提升来促进社会对AI技术的理解和接受。
7. 成本问题:AI系统的开发和维护成本较高,这限制了其在一些领域的应用。为了降低成本,可以采取以下措施:首先,优化算法和技术以提高计算效率;其次,采用开源技术和社区支持来降低研发成本;最后,通过规模化生产和自动化来降低生产成本。
总之,解决AI应用的常见问题需要综合考虑多个方面,包括数据质量、模型泛化能力、可解释性、计算资源消耗、安全性、伦理法律问题以及成本问题。通过不断的技术创新和实践探索,我们可以逐步克服这些挑战,推动AI技术的健康发展。